Feature #1802
closed
qa: test to exercise divergent osd logs
Added by Sage Weil over 12 years ago.
Updated about 12 years ago.
Description
- generate some write/overwrite workload with many concurrent writes
- extend ceph_manager to pause (kill STOP) an osd process
pause one replica, wait long enough for the other to commit several writes
- kill the unpaused one
- unpause the paused one
- let it recover, and continue writing
- restart killed osd
This should at least exercise the divergent log handling. Not sure how we can verify the result...
- Translation missing: en.field_position set to 60
- Target version changed from v0.40 to v0.41
- Translation missing: en.field_position deleted (
89)
- Translation missing: en.field_position set to 8
- Translation missing: en.field_position deleted (
21)
- Translation missing: en.field_position set to 104
- Translation missing: en.field_story_points set to 8
- Translation missing: en.field_position deleted (
104)
- Translation missing: en.field_position set to 29
- Target version deleted (
v0.41)
- Translation missing: en.field_position deleted (
30)
- Translation missing: en.field_position set to 1
- Status changed from New to 12
- Target version set to v0.45
- % Done changed from 0 to 50
the backfill.py exercises a divergent backfill target. we just need to do the same on a non-backfill target.
- Translation missing: en.field_position deleted (
62)
- Translation missing: en.field_position set to 1
- Status changed from 12 to Resolved
Also available in: Atom
PDF